Broadly speaking, lethality is better versus squishies, and cleaver is better for those building armour. So if you see a tankless team, perhaps lethality is a better choice. (Occasionally people make the mistake of thinking lethality counters armour, which is backwards.)

Although cleaver/deaths dance is going to make you much more survivable, so you can be a bit scrappier instead of assassin-y. If you find yourself forced into a lot of extended fights with multiple damage sources, lethality riven might be able to burst one of the squishies, but she might have a harder time surviving to deal with the next one. Deaths dance/clever is going to make insta bursting a squishy harder, but you'll probably survive to try again.

Lethality if you're looking to be killing squishies for the most part.

DD/lifesteal if you wanna fight tankier targets (and LW).

BC is pretty much core though, even if you're itemizing into an assassin the stats and passive work against any laner you might go up against. Rushing Youmu(u)'s or Maw might be better in certain matchups though.

Fervor for long trades, Tlords for short trades. Fervor scales well against tanks and juggernauts, while Tlords is more effective for wombo's and assassinations.
